How do online public health programs prepare graduates for epidemiology roles and responsibilities?
Online public health programs tailored to epidemiology careers focus on integrating advanced quantitative techniques with applied disease surveillance, equipping graduates with skills critical for real-time outbreak analysis. These programs emphasize proficiency in biostatistics, geographic information systems (GIS), and data platforms, mirroring employer demands for operational effectiveness in settings such as government agencies and hospitals. For instance, epidemiologists in state health departments must rapidly link diverse datasets to track disease spread, a competency sharpened through case projects and simulation.
Preparing graduates for epidemiology roles through accredited online public health education involves training in population-based study design that directly informs policy and emergency response resource allocation. Additionally, ethical considerations, communication strategies, and emergency preparedness coursework foster interdisciplinary collaboration essential in crisis environments. Employers prioritize candidates able to immediately contribute to outbreak detection, data integrity, and health impact evaluation.
Tradeoffs arise as asynchronous coursework must often be balanced with synchronous labs or practicum experiences requiring local placements; this can limit hands-on exposure important for workforce readiness. Prospective students should assess a program's local partnerships to optimize practical learning. Demand for epidemiologists is projected to grow 27% from 2022 to 2032, emphasizing the value of integrating both theoretical knowledge and practical disease modeling skills.

What accreditation should online public health and epidemiology programs have in the United States?
CEPH accreditation remains a decisive factor for online public health program accreditation in the United States, shaping access to essential epidemiology roles across government and industry. Graduates from non-CEPH accredited programs routinely encounter barriers to federal hiring panels and certification tracks such as the Certified in Public Health (CPH), which employers prefer and which non-accredited graduates cannot pursue effectively.
Programs lacking CEPH status often struggle with delivering required applied epidemiology practicum placements, severely limiting experiential learning. For example, a candidate aiming for a state health department epidemiology position may be disqualified due to insufficient practical exposure, reflecting how accreditation enforces a baseline competency recognized by public sector agencies.
The pragmatic benefits of accredited epidemiology degrees for US students are evident in wage outcomes: Texas A&M's online MPH graduates report starting salaries exceeding $100,000 based on five years of survey data. This suggests that degree value aligns closely with program rigor and employer trust in accredited training.
Prospective students should rigorously evaluate programs by their CEPH status, integration of practicum experience, and recognition by targeted employers. How do online public health degrees compare to campus-based programs for epidemiology?
Employers in epidemiology consistently emphasize applied competencies and relevant experience over whether a degree was earned online or on campus. Online public health degree benefits for epidemiology include significant cost savings and scheduling flexibility, critical for professionals balancing ongoing work in health departments or field settings. For example, a practitioner engaged in local disease surveillance can integrate an online MPH program with real-time projects, enhancing practical skills while minimizing financial and logistical burdens.
Texas A&M's online MPH in Epidemiology tuition, around $17,727 for residents and $38,069 for nonresidents, exemplifies more affordable pathways compared to many campus-based programs where total costs often surpass $50,000 after accounting for housing and transportation. This affordability can critically influence return on investment, especially since public agencies and NGOs typically offer modest entry salaries relative to graduates' debt burdens.
On the other hand, campus-based versus online public health programs for epidemiology differ notably in hands-on training and networking. Campus settings often provide direct access to laboratories and immediate faculty interaction essential for advanced biostatistical or outbreak investigation skills. Recent graduates who lack professional placement opportunities might find a campus environment better suited to developing these competencies comprehensively.
Online students must proactively seek internships or practicum placements to offset gaps in experiential learning commonly encountered in virtual curricula. What are typical admission requirements for online public health degrees focused on epidemiology?
Applicants pursuing online epidemiology degrees must meet rigorous academic and experiential thresholds that align with employer expectations and the demands of disease surveillance roles. A bachelor's degree in health sciences, biology, or related quantitative fields with a GPA near 3.5 is often necessary; lesser GPAs may hinder admission due to the technical rigor expected. Comprehensive applications include transcripts, recommendations confirming quantitative aptitude, and personal statements detailing epidemiologic or public health experience.
While GRE scores are increasingly optional, they serve as useful standardized metrics for candidates with weaker academic backgrounds or limited field experience. Professionals without traditional degrees face added scrutiny, needing to provide robust documentation of relevant work. Admissions committees emphasize prerequisite knowledge in biostatistics and calculus, reflecting the analytic demands in real-world epidemiology jobs within healthcare agencies or government settings.
Operationally, applicants should be prepared for digital submission portals, background checks especially for clinical research components, and virtual interviews that evaluate communication skills essential for multidisciplinary collaboration. These processes can lengthen timelines and affect working students balancing employment. How long do online public health epidemiology programs take, and what do they cost?
Choosing an epidemiology program requires balancing time, cost, and career timing against specific workforce demands. Master's degrees, typically two years full-time or up to three part-time, serve as the common gateway but differ sharply in structure and price. Accelerated options shorten study to 12-18 months but impose heavier workloads and reduced employment flexibility.
Doctoral tracks extend from four to six years, often stretching longer for part-time students juggling jobs. Tuition averages between $400 and $900 per credit hour, translating to costs from $15,000 to $45,000 for master's programs. Factors like public vs. private institutions, residency, and lab or fieldwork fees can significantly affect these figures. Employer tuition reimbursement or federal loans may mitigate upfront expenses but do not eliminate long-term financial implications.
Specializations such as infectious disease, chronic disease, and environmental epidemiology increasingly align with employer demand, especially in CEPH-accredited programs emphasizing multi-specialty skills.
Part-time students employed by health agencies often prioritize steady income over rapid credentialing, accepting delayed advancement.
Early-career professionals may choose accelerated formats to quickly scale skills despite higher per-credit costs and workload intensity.
Selecting a program demands understanding these tradeoffs: whether faster skill acquisition justifies cost and intensity or whether longer timelines offer better work-study balance without sacrificing employability.
What epidemiology careers can you pursue with an online public health degree?
Epidemiology-focused online public health degrees offer pathways into specialized roles like epidemiologist, biostatistician, infectious disease specialist, and public health analyst, each demanding distinct technical and contextual competencies. For instance, an epidemiologist at a state health department may manage COVID-19 surveillance and vaccination planning, while a biostatistician in pharma applies statistical expertise to clinical trial data supporting FDA filings.
A critical enrollment consideration is the growing number of top online MPH programs-including UNC Chapel Hill and George Washington University-dropping GRE requirements, facilitating access for professionals balancing career shifts or advancement without standardized testing barriers. This shift aligns with employers' prioritization of applied skills such as SAS/R proficiency and real-time epidemiologic data analysis over traditional admissions metrics.
Employers typically expect demonstrated expertise in study design, outbreak investigation, and health equity assessment, with private sector roles favoring predictive modeling and surveillance system development. Students must therefore strategically curate electives and practicum experiences to meet these differing demands.
Graduates without clinical backgrounds can enter analyst or research coordinator roles, yet positions involving laboratorian duties or clinical trial management usually require additional credentials or hands-on experience. Online MPH programs offering local practicum placements help mitigate challenges inherent in acquiring necessary field experience remotely.

What salary ranges and earning potential exist for epidemiologists and related public health roles?
Salary outcomes for epidemiologists in the United States vary sharply with experience, job type, and sector, demonstrating distinct tradeoffs for professionals considering graduate credentials. Entry-level epidemiologists earn around $50,000 annually, while senior roles exceed $120,000, particularly within specialized fields or federal agencies. Related roles like biostatisticians or public health advisors start closer to $60,000 but can surpass $130,000 in private biotech firms.
The availability of 100% online MPH programs with no residency requirements critically supports midcareer professionals seeking advancement without interrupting employment. For example, a state health department analyst earning $65,000 might face stagnant growth without an MPH, whereas completing an online program can open supervisory roles paying $90,000 or more. However, this requires weighing tuition and time investment against realistic salary gains.
Employers prioritize candidates who combine hands-on experience with credentials from accredited programs. Graduates aiming for research institutions or pharmaceutical companies often access higher salaries but must navigate rigorous hiring standards and credential expectations, unlike more stable yet modest public health roles in local government. Long-term earnings rely heavily on continuous skill development, especially in data analytics and grant management.

How is the job outlook for epidemiologists, and where is demand growing most?
Epidemiology employment growth, projected at 9% from 2024 to 2034, is driven primarily by pharmaceutical research and biotechnology sectors, which demand specialized skills in data analysis and bioinformatics. Practitioners in pharmaceuticals often engage in complex clinical trial evaluations and drug safety monitoring, requiring advanced quantitative skills beyond foundational public health training.
Government health agencies such as the CDC prioritize fieldwork, surveillance, and communication abilities for infectious disease tracking and emerging threats. This divergence means students must weigh the practical tradeoff between broad public health degrees with an epidemiology emphasis versus specialized master's or doctoral programs. The latter typically demand more scientific coursework but lead to higher-paying roles, especially in biotech and research settings.
Key workforce considerations include:
Pharmaceutical employers seek candidates proficient in biostatistics and programming.
Government roles value outbreak investigation experience and regulatory familiarity.
Geographic clusters with biotech industries offer more concentrated job opportunities and advancement potential.
Long-term success requires building applied experience early and ongoing skill development tailored to sector demands. Is pursuing an online public health degree worth it for epidemiology careers when considering hands-on experience?
Online public health programs often have a limited scope for practical, hands-on epidemiology training compared to in-person formats. This creates a significant tradeoff: students need to proactively seek internships or field placements independently to build applied skills employers value. Programs that integrate capstone projects or require practicum hours can partly mitigate this gap, but prospective students should prioritize options offering structured experiential components to remain competitive in epidemiology job markets.
How important is the faculty's epidemiology expertise in online public health degree programs?
Faculty expertise directly influences the quality of epidemiology instruction and relevance of the curriculum to current public health challenges. Programs staffed with active researchers or professionals in epidemiology provide better insights into real-world applications and emerging trends. When evaluating programs, prioritize those where faculty have recent field experience or significant contributions to epidemiology research, as this affects both learning depth and career networking opportunities.
Should I choose an online public health degree with a broad focus or one specifically tailored to epidemiology?
A specialized epidemiology track improves readiness for epidemiology roles by emphasizing critical statistical methods and outbreak investigation skills. However, broader public health programs may offer more flexibility for shifting career interests or pursuing multidisciplinary roles. If your goal is a strict epidemiology career, choose programs with targeted epidemiology coursework and practical modules. Otherwise, a general public health degree might suit those valuing versatility over deep specialization.
How do online public health programs accommodate working professionals aiming for epidemiology careers?
Most online public health degrees provide asynchronous coursework that fits varied schedules, which is optimal for working adults. Nonetheless, the intensity and volume of data analysis and statistics assignments can demand significant time investment. Programs that allow part-time enrollment or extended completion timelines better support balancing work and study. Prioritize programs with clear guidance on workload expectations to ensure you can maintain job performance while advancing your epidemiology credentials.
